Detailed analysis of the Mazda 2 3p Active+ 1.3 86 CV (2008-2009)
General description
The 2007 Mazda2, in its 3-door Active+ version with a 1.3 86 hp engine, is presented as a compact and agile option. Priced at €13,350, this model aims to win over those who value efficiency and fun handling in the urban segment. Its fresh design and balanced performance make it an interesting contender for everyday use.
Driving experience
Behind the wheel of the Mazda2, the predominant feeling is one of agility and lightness. Its 86 hp, combined with a weight of only 1025 kg, give it a lively response, especially in urban environments. The electric power steering is precise and the suspension, McPherson type at the front and torsion beam with trailing arm at the rear, offers a good balance between comfort and dynamism. It acc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in 12.9 seconds and reaches a top speed of 172 km/h, adequate figures for its segment. The combined consumption of 5.4 l/100km is a plus for daily economy.
Design and aesthetics
The design of the 2007 Mazda2 is modern and youthful, with lines that convey dynamism. The 3-door body accentuates its sporty and compact character. Its dimensions of 3885 mm long, 1695 mm wide and 1475 mm high make it ideal for the city, facilitating parking and maneuverability. The interior, although not luxurious, is well resolved and offers a 250-liter trunk, sufficient for daily needs.
Technology and features
In terms of technology, the 2007 Mazda2 incorporates a 1349 cc gasoline engine with 4 cylinders and 16 valves, delivering 86 hp at 6000 rpm and a torque of 122 Nm at 3500 rpm. Indirect injection and aluminum construction of the block and cylinder head are notable features. The 5-speed manual transmission is smooth and precise. In the braking section, it has 258 mm ventilated discs at the front and 200 mm drums at the rear, a standard configuration for its category. The rack and pinion steering with electric assistance contributes to comfortable and efficient driving.
Competition
The Mazda2 competes in a very crowded segment, facing models such as the Ford Fiesta, Renault Clio, Volkswagen Polo or Toyota Yaris. Compared to them, the Mazda2 stands out for its lightness, agile handling and distinctive design. While some rivals may offer more engine options or a more sophisticated interior, the Mazda2 is positioned as an attractive alternative for those looking for a reliable and fun-to-drive car with low consumption.
